Ocasio-Cortez Set to Join Maxine Waters on Key Financial Services Committee

Self-described socialist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ez announced on Twitter Tuesday that she will join California Democratic Rep. Maxine Waters on the House Financial Services Committee.

Fox News reports Ocasio-Cortez said in her tweet, "Personally, I’m looking forward to digging into the student loan crisis, examining for-profit prisons/ICE detention, and exploring the development of public & postal banking.”

The 29-year-old has suggested that the nation's largest banks should be broken up.

She has also struggled to explain how she would fund her proposals to provide Medicare for all and guarantee housing and education, and has falsely claimed that wasteful military spending could be used to pay for her laundry list of policy goals.
